Six-year-old Baylee Spence of Port Angeles looks over holiday confections at the Original Christmas Cottage craft and gift fair on Friday at Vern Burton Community Center, 308 E. Fourth St., in Port Angeles. The annual three-day fair features thousands of holiday gifts and decorations created by North Olympic Peninsula artisans. It continues Saturday from 9 a.m. to 6 p.m. and Sunday from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m.
